LF
Mr
Small-Business (50 or fewer emp.)
"Ease of using IBM RPA for data migrations from legacy systems"
What do you like best about IBM Robotic Process Automation (RPA)?

The ease of programming interactions with the screen (Desktop Automation), using only Drag&Drop and reading Excel files without needing to open Excel on the screen, are points that greatly facilitate my work in automating data migration between legacy systems. Review collected by and hosted on G2.com.

What do you dislike about IBM Robotic Process Automation (RPA)?

Database interaction commands like Bulk Insert are not fast in execution. Before executing the command, it is necessary to prepare the data in a data table to use the command. When I am working with many tables, this affects performance. Review collected by and hosted on G2.com.

Verified User in Food Production
CF
Small-Business (50 or fewer emp.)
"Simple to structure, to program, to debug, and to put into production"
What do you like best about IBM Robotic Process Automation (RPA)?

The IBM RPA Studio is very easy to use. Visually, it has the appearance of a programming IDE, which makes it easy to follow visually, whether in designer or script mode.

The variety of commands allows you to automate many processes. Even in complicated graphical interfaces, the interface recognition via OCR adds a lot of versatility to the platform.

The automatic report generator is a very powerful feature when you need to work with specialized reports, whose data comes from different sources.

I like the functionality of deploying multiple versions of the same robot at once, which allows you to make improvements and test its operation in a test environment without needing to touch the production version. Review collected by and hosted on G2.com.

What do you dislike about IBM Robotic Process Automation (RPA)?

Among the disadvantages, I see that some concepts are a bit difficult to understand, such as exception handling.

Also, the way of handling some control flow commands, such as managing multiple conditions within an IF, which makes it necessary to add many more commands than needed. Review collected by and hosted on G2.com.
